r-bioc-alabaster.schemas
Schemas for the Alabaster Framework
Stores all schemas required by various alabaster.* packages. No
computation should be performed by this package, as that is handled by
alabaster.base. We use a separate package instead of storing the schemas
in alabaster.base itself, to avoid conflating management of the schemas
with code maintenence.
atomes
atomic-scale 3D modeling toolbox
Atomes is a tool box to analyze (physico-chemical properties calculations),
visualize (atoms, bonds, colormaps, measurements, coordination polyedra ...)
create (crystal builder, molecular library, surface creation and
passivation ...) 3D atomistic models.
Atomes offers a workspace capable of handling many projects opened
simultaneously.
The different projects in the workspace can exchange data: analysis results,
atomic coordinates...
Atomes also provides an advanced input preparation system for further
calculations using well known molecular dynamics codes:
Classical MD: DLPOLY and LAMMPS
- ab-initio MD: CPMD and CP2K
- QM-MM MD: CPMD and CP2K
To prepare the input files for these calculations is likely to be the key, and
most complicated step towards MD simulations.
Atomes offers a user-friendly assistant to help and guide the scientist step
by step to achieve this crucial step.
libnvrtc-builtins11.7
CUDA Runtime Compilation (NVIDIA NVRTC Builtins Library)
CUDA Runtime Compilation library (nvrtc) provides an API to compile
CUDA-C++ device source code at runtime.
sass-stylesheets-bulma
Sass and CSS framework using flexbox
Bulma is a Sass and CSS framework
that provides ready-to-use frontend components
that you can easily combine to build responsive web interfaces.
ruby-ipaddr
class to manipulate an IP address in ruby
IPAddr provides a set of methods to manipulate an IP address.
Both IPv4 and IPv6 are supported.
r-bioc-gsvadata
Data employed in the vignette of the GSVA package
This package stores the data employed in the vignette of the GSVA package.
These data belong to the following publications:
- Armstrong et al. Nat Genet 30:41-47, 2002
- Cahoy et al. J Neurosci 28:264-278, 2008
- Carrel and Willard, Nature, 434:400-404, 2005
- Huang et al. PNAS, 104:9758-9763, 2007
- Pickrell et al. Nature, 464:768-722, 2010
- Skaletsky et al. Nature, 423:825-837
- Verhaak et al. Cancer Cell 17:98-110, 2010
